Abstract

The utility model discloses a door and window and railing automatic tracking welding machine: the welding platform is arranged on the movable platform seat, a positioning area is defined by the welding platform on the movable platform seat, the welding platform slides along the length direction of the movable platform seat to adjust the size of the positioning area, and a to-be-welded part is placed in the positioning area; the welding platform is provided with a positioning assembly and an automatic welding assembly, the positioning assembly is fixed at the position of the seam of the piece to be welded in an extruding mode, and the automatic welding assembly is arranged on the seam of the piece to be welded in a sliding welding mode; the automatic welding assembly automatically welds the abutted seams of the parts to be welded, so that the welding efficiency of the parts to be welded is improved, manual welding is not needed, and the labor cost of the parts to be welded is reduced; the welding platform is arranged on the moving platform base in a sliding mode, so that the positioning area can fix the parts to be welded with different sizes.

Detailed Description
The present invention will be further described with reference to the accompanying drawings.
The automatic tracking welding machine for doors, windows and railings as shown in the attached figures 1-5 comprises: including welded platform 1 and moving platform seat 7, moving platform seat 7 is fixed on the equipment chassis through preceding fixing base 21 and back fixing base 25. The welding platform 1 is arranged on the movable platform base 7 in a sliding mode; a plurality of welding platforms 1 are encircled to form a positioning area 11, and the to-be-welded piece 2 is placed in the positioning area 11; the welding platform 1 slides along the length direction of the moving platform base 7 to adjust the size of the positioning area 11; through controlling parallel rectilinear movement with welded platform 1, the distance size that corresponds two welded platform 1 is according to treating 2 sizes of weldment and confirms, after confirming the size, the fixing base that the both sides correspond about rethread welded platform 1 fixes welded platform 1 on moving platform seat 7, like this welded platform 1 encloses to become to have the regional 11 of location and to treat that the overall dimension of weldment sets up with cooperateing, is convenient for carry out fixed weld to the not unidimensional weldment 2 of treating.
The movable platform 1 is provided with a movable cylinder 8, the top end of a movable column of the movable cylinder 8 is connected with an angle fixed plate 81, and when the movable cylinder 8 symmetrically extends out, the angle fixed plate 81 forms an inner positioning reference point of the part to be welded 2; the moving cylinder 8 with the angle fixing plate 81 retracted facilitates the discharge of the work to be welded 2. The welding platform 1 is provided with a positioning component 3 and an automatic welding component 4, the positioning component 3 is fixed at the position of the butt joint of the piece to be welded 2 in an extruding mode, and the automatic welding component 4 is arranged for sliding welding to the butt joint of the piece to be welded 2; the positioning assembly 3 fixes and positions the to-be-welded part 2 in multiple directions, and meanwhile, automatic sliding welding is carried out through the automatic welding assembly 4 without manual welding, so that the welding efficiency of the to-be-welded part 2 is improved, and the manual production cost of the to-be-welded part 2 is reduced; meanwhile, the welding of the edge joints of the pieces to be welded 2 is smooth, uniform and beautiful.
The fixing component 3 comprises a horizontal extrusion structure 31 and a vertical extrusion structure 32; the horizontal extrusion structures 31 are extrusion cylinders, and the horizontal extrusion structures 31 are respectively extruded horizontally inwards on two side edges of the parts to be welded 2; the vertical extrusion structures 32 are arranged right above two side edges of the parts to be welded 2, and the vertical extrusion structures 32 are arranged on the parts to be welded 2 in a jacking and pressing mode from top to bottom; therefore, the fixing component 3 fixes the to-be-welded part 2 from the horizontal direction, the reverse direction and the vertical direction, and the phenomenon that the to-be-welded part 2 moves in the welding process to affect the attractiveness of the seam welding is avoided.
The vertical extrusion structure 32 comprises a propelling cylinder 321 and a pressing cylinder 322, the top end of a telescopic column of the propelling cylinder 321 is fixedly provided with the pressing cylinder 322 through a fixing bracket 323, and the telescopic pressing end of the pressing cylinder 322 is vertically arranged downwards; the propulsion cylinder 321 extends to drive the pressing cylinder 322 to move right above the side edge of the to-be-welded part 2, and the telescopic pressing end of the pressing cylinder 322 is vertically pressed downwards on the surface of the side edge of the to-be-welded part 2; thereby completing the vertical direction fixation of the parts to be welded. Meanwhile, the pushing cylinder 321 drives the pressing cylinder 322 to be far away from the side edge of the part to be welded 2, so that the part to be welded 2 can be conveniently placed or detached.
The automatic welding assembly 4 comprises a welding gun 41, a welding gun linear driving motor 42 and a moving flat plate 43, wherein the moving flat plate 43 is arranged on a precision screw 421 of the welding gun linear driving motor 42 in a threaded manner, the precision screw 421 rotates, and the moving flat plate 43 slides along the axial direction of the precision screw 421; the moving direction of the moving flat plate 43 is parallel to the linear direction of the abutted seam of the piece to be welded 2; the welding gun 41 is arranged on the movable flat plate 43, and the welding port of the welding gun 41 is horizontally arranged opposite to the abutted seam of the workpiece 42 to be welded; the welding accuracy of the butt seam of the part to be welded 2 by the welding gun 41 is guaranteed by the accurate movement of the movable flat plate on the precise screw 421.
The moving flat plate 43 is arranged on a welding gun transverse driving motor 44, and the welding gun transverse driving motor 44 is horizontally and vertically arranged on the welding gun linear driving motor 42; the welding gun 41 is arranged at the top end of a telescopic shaft of the welding gun transverse driving motor 44, so that the welding gun 41 can move perpendicular to the length direction of the abutted seam of the parts 2 to be welded. When the seam allowance of the piece to be welded 2 is large, the welding gun 41 can move along the seam allowance length and weld, and meanwhile, the welding gun 41 is driven by the welding gun transverse driving motor 44 to swing left and right along the seam allowance width direction, so that the welding device can quickly and effectively weld the piece to be welded 2 with large seam allowance.
The automatic tracking induction head 5 is arranged on a welding gun 41, and a signal transmission end of the automatic tracking induction head 5 is respectively connected with a signal input end of the welding gun 41 and a signal input end of a welding gun linear driving motor 42; the induction table 6 is arranged on the welding platform 1, and the relative position of the induction table 6 is an extension reference point of a starting point of a piece to be welded. When the welding gun 41 is driven by the welding gun linear driving motor 42 to gradually approach the part to be welded 2, the automatic tracking induction head 5 gradually approaches and gradually contacts the induction table 6 along with the welding gun 41; at the moment, the welding port of the welding gun 41 just contacts the butt joint of the part to be welded 2, the automatic tracking induction head 5 sends an electric signal to the welding gun 6, so that the welding gun 41 starts to weld the butt joint of the part to be welded 2, and meanwhile, the automatic tracking induction head 5 sends an electric signal to the welding gun linear driving motor 42, so that the welding gun linear driving motor 42 pushes the moving speed of the welding gun 41 to be converted into the welding process speed; when the welding gun 41 slides along the abutted seams for a period of time to finish the abutted seam welding of the parts to be welded 2, the welding gun 41 automatically stops working; the same linear driving motor 42 rotates reversely and drives the welding gun 41 to move away from the part to be welded 2 and return to the initial position. Thereby completing the entire welding process.
